Google Nexus 7 Specifications User Manual Price
Google Nexus 7 Specifications, User Manual, Price - The latest news for the Google Nexus 7 tablet. This tablet additionally typically referred to as because the Asus Nexus tablet or Google Nexus tablet. It comes with Quad core, 1300 MHz processor with Tegra three chip and runs on the android (4.1) package. itll be discharged Q3 2012. It has 7.00 inches, IPS LCD, Capacitive, Multi-touch Touchscreen, 1280 x 800 pixels resolution. The tablet has physical Dimensions of 198.5 x 120 x ten.45 mm with weight regarding 340 g. the inner storage feature of this tablet embrace 16000 MB and different possibility embrace 8000 MB (8 GB), sadly the external memory not out there. The Google Nexus 7 is tablet that has blessings like supported by a high speed processor and much of RAM. a lot of detail regarding the Google Nexus 7 Specifications, different options, User Manual download PDF, and worth data as follows:
Google Nexus 7 Tablet Full Specifications:
- Available 1024 MB RAM
- Supported by NVidia GeForce 12-core GPU Graphics processor
- Equippes with camcoder and front facing camera
- Powered by 4325 mAh, stand by time: 300 hours
- Support YouTube (upload), Picasa, HTML, HTML5, Chrome browser for access the internet
- Connectivity: Bluetooth, Wi-fi 802.11 b, g, n, a, USB 2.0, NFC, Computer sync, OTA sync
- Other features and specs: YouTube player, Music player, GPS, Unlimited entries phonebook, Calendar, Alarm, Document viewer, Calculator, email, Music ringtones (MP3), Polyphonic ringtones, Vibration, Accelerometer, Gyroscope, Compass, Voice commands, Voice recording

Magic W3 Tablet Smartphone Windows 7 Home Premium
MaGic W3, Tablet Smartphone Windows 7 - Magic W3 uses 1.6 GHz Intel Atom processor Z530 and the operating system for Windows 7 Home Premium. Mini Tablet can also used for a phone call, giving new meaning to the word "Windows Phone."

Windows 7 that is used in the device is similar to ordinary computer or notebook, not Windows Phone 7 which is for smartphones. Z530 is not the fastest chip processor to handle the tasks of Windows but the greatness of this tablet as it also is a phone that runs Windows OS 7.
Magic W3 has a 800 x 480 pixels screen resolution, and comes with 1GB of DDR2 RAM, 32GB SSD storage, 802.11b/g WiFi, Bluetooth 2.0, GPS, and modem and HSPA GSM Quad Band 3.5 g. Tablet smartphone has a 3.7V 3200mAh battery, 1.3MP camera, an accelerometer and vibration capability. This miniature device has an HDMI port, mini USB port, microSD card slot, SIM card slot, dual mic, and stereo speakers.

Samsung Galaxy Tab 7 7 Rp 7 5 Million
Samsung Galaxy Tab 7.7, Rp 7, 5 Million - Less than a week after the Galaxy Nexus market, Samsung introduced the latest Tablet PC Samsung Galaxy Tab 7.7 to the Indonesian market. This is the first tablet of the Galaxy series that uses AMOLED display plus super.
Samsung Galaxy Tab 7.7 is a development from the previous Galaxy series, comes with Super AMOLED Plus technology, with a screen size of 1280 x 800 (WXGA), giving the user experience with a color display screen contrast and sharper. This type of super AMOLED screen is made ??more perfect for color, contrast ratio, sharpness and speed of responding. This makes the text more clear and sharp, including a full color, no matter from any angle look at it.

Honeycomb Android operating system that has been perfected which they called the Android version 3.2. New technologies increasingly make this tablet more slender and more lightweight than ever, with 7.89 millimeter thinness makes this tablet is much thinner than the Samsung Galaxy SII 8.49 millimeters thick. It weighs only 340 grams or even equal 12 ounces.
Samsung Galaxy Tab 7.7 in armed with a dual core 1.4GHz processor, 32 GB internal memory, microSD slot, a 3MP camera (rear) and 2MP (front). It is also equipped with features TouchWiz UX Mini Apps, which can operate the task manager or calendar simultaneously.
Samsung Galaxy Tab 7.7 is equipped with a capacity of 5100 mAh battery that makes the video playback on this tablet can last up to 10 hours or 50 hours of music. These tablets are sold at a price of USD 7.499 million that will be bundled with the service operator XL.

Nokia 703 Windows Mobile Phone 7 First Nokia
Nokia 703 Windows Mobile Phone 7 - Nokia will release a phone with OS WP7 at the end of this year. As for info about one of WP 7, the Nokia 703 is leaking in the virtual world featuring pictures and little information about its specifications.
Little is known as "480 � 800 pixels LCD 3.7 inch" on the side labeled "DISPLAY". And that looks a lot like "5MP" and "@ 720p 30fps" next to the camera. The internal storage capacity of 8GB and seemed to 512MB of RAM memory.
It should be noted that the Nokia phone with OS WP7 first, it is not manufactured in nokia because rush deadlines, and the phone is not using OS WP7 modifications from Nokia. The next cell phone will then use the nokia OS modifications, one of which is Window Phone Tango.

Samsung Announces Galaxy 7 0 Plus
Samsung Announces Galaxy 7.0 Plus - After the success of Galaxy Tab 10.1 and 8.9, Samsung Electronics Indonesia (Sein) ready to present a new tablet in the months ahead. Samsung officially announced the new Android tablets of the Galaxy Series Galaxy Plus 7.0.
Galaxy Plus 7.0 Android operating system to adopt the latest version of the Honeycomb 3.2. 1.2 G Hz processor using dual cores (up from 1 GHz). For memory business, strengthened Galaxy 7.0 Plus 1 GB of RAM, with a choice of 16 GB and 32 G
B of storage capacity. There is also a 3 megapixel camera on the back and 2 megapixel camera on the front.
Because the Galaxy Plus 7.0 has support for quad-band GSM/GPRS/EDGE, meaning you can use these tablets for SMS and phone. Additionally GTab 7 Plus also supports tri-band 3G with speed 21 Mbps HSPA. For the storage capacity you can choose GTab 7 Plus 16GB or 32GB plus a card slot for memory cards. Other features include dual-band Wi-Fi a/b/g/n, GPS and Bluetooth.
Galaxy Plus 7.0 uses a powerful 4000 mAh battery. Overall dimensions are 193.65 x 122.37 x 9.96 mm with a weight of only 345gr. Display Samsung Galaxy 7.0 Plus resembles previous versions, but there is a line that surrounds the body as a sweetener.
